Check Characteristics

The Check Characteristics file is a configuration file for the Station measurements Quality Gate check. The schema and example provided illustrates how to structure the Check Characteristics XML file.

Example

Click to unfold
<?xml version="1.0" standalone="yes"?>
<WFSConfigDataSet xmlns="http://tempuri.org/WFSConfigDataSet.xsd">
  <WFSGroups>
    <TargetKey>WFS1</TargetKey>
    <DataSource>QualityDb</DataSource>
  </WFSGroups>
  <WFSSystems>
    <InfoType>WFS</InfoType>
    <ExpectedValues>0,1,2,3</ExpectedValues>
    <WFSGroupTargetKey>WFS1</WFSGroupTargetKey>
  </WFSSystems>
</WFSConfigDataSet>

Description

WFSGroups element

Parameter Description

TargetKey

Name of the WFS group. Corresponds to the input parameter of the request.

DataSource

Name of the associated data source. Corresponds to the name of the database connection.

WFSSystems element

Parameter Description

InfoType

Name of the WFS system.
Possible values when using WFSControl: FAZIT, FBS4, MAC.
Possible values when used without WFSControl: All values that were used as constants or variables for input via DirectDataLink

ExpectedValues

Permissible target values for WFS transfer state. Multiple values separated by a comma.

WFSGroupTargetKey

Referenced WFSGroups.TargetKey
